Output 24e422523c1944991f287f69beaad8fb3686962691f038675ff46951c14e2087:16

value
676220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4079c3ae7370cd732d24b1ea235dfe4fc8eba605 OP_EQUAL
address
37Zw3A95B9nPZXrBM7fADXpYnKbP5iCcE5
transaction
24e422523c1944991f287f69beaad8fb3686962691f038675ff46951c14e2087
spent
true